Kraft Fluid Systems Appoints Territory Manager for Northern WI

Adam Cornell joins the Cleveland-based distributor of hydraulic equipment and mobile drive solutions.

Kraft Fluid Systems

CLEVELAND, OH — Kraft Fluid Systems welcomes Adam Cornell as a new territory manager in Wisconsin. Cornell has been tasked with developing a new Danfoss territory in the northern part of the state.

Cornell most recently managed a territory focused on supplying Danfoss products for fluid power distributor Certified Power Solutions’ snow and ice division. Previous to that, he supported mobile and industrial accounts at Fluid System Components, a distributor of hydraulic and pneumatic components, systems, hydraulic power units, and electronics.

“Adam brings two decades of hydraulics industry experience across industrial and mobile applications,” said Pat Green, sales manager for Kraft Fluid Systems, Inc. “We look forward to working with him to extend our service territory and help match OEM customers with hydraulic and electronic control solutions from Danfoss and others to fulfill their system needs.”

Cornell is a graduate of Chippewa Valley Technical College with a hydraulic maintenance technical diploma. His expertise includes hydraulics knowledge in the marine, wind power, industrial pressing, snow removal equipment, and government sales sectors. He lives in Fond du Lac, Wisconsin with his wife and two children and enjoys cooking, camping, and other local outdoor activities.

“I am very excited to be in my home state working with Kraft Fluid Systems,” said Cornell. “I look forward to developing a new Danfoss territory with an industry leader in technical understanding and outstanding customer service.”

Kraft Fluid Systems a Midwest industrial distributor of hydraulic equipment and provider of mobile drive solutions. The company sells, services and inventories mobile hydraulic equipment.
